Candidates who clear all phases of the selection process will be appointed as Junior Administrative Assistant (JAA). The Grade Pay for JAA is Rs.6,200. Gauhati High Court JAA Salary 2026
The Gauhati High Court Junior Administrative Assistant Salary 2026 offers an attractive pay scale ranging from ₹14,000 to ₹70,000, depending on the district. Along with the basic pay, employees receive allowances such as DA, HRA, CCA, and performance-based incentives. The overall package also includes benefits like medical insurance, gratuity, and retirement perks, ensuring financial stability and security.

| Gauhati High Court JAA Salary 2026 | |
| Organization Name | Gauhati High Court |
| Post | Junior Administrative Assistant (JAA) |
| Vacancy | 367 |
| Selection Process | Written exam, Skill test, Viva voice |
| Basic Pay | Rs. 6,200 |
| Salary | Rs.14,000 to Rs.70,000 |
| Official Website | https://ghconline.gov.in/ |

Gauhati HC Junior Administrative Assistant Perks And Allowances
In addition to an attractive salary, Gauhati HC JAA receives several benefits and allowances like other High Court Employees. Take a look at the Perks and Allowances provided by HC:
| Allowances | |
| Dearness Allowance (DA) | Provided in line with government regulations to help mitigate the effects of inflation. |
| City Compensatory Allowance (CCA) | Awarded to employees working in metropolitan areas. |
| House Rent Allowance (HRA) | House Rent (varies from city to city) |
| Transport Allowance (TA) | Helps cover commuting expenses. |
| Benefits | |
| Medical Coverage | Medical health coverage to family members |
| Gratuity | A lump sum payment after completing a specified period of service. |
| Pension & Retirement Benefits | Monthly pension for a stable life after retirement period |
| Leave Allowance | Leave benefits include various paid leave options, such as casual leave, medical leave, and earned leave. |
| Career Growth | Promotions and Departmental tests help in securing a higher-level position in Job. |
Apart from the Allowances employee’s salary will be deducted for the following contributions:
- Income Tax
- Equity Linked Savings Scheme (ELSS)
- Employee Provident Fund (EPF)
- Annuity/ Pension Schemes.
- Contribution to PPF Account etc
